I just upgraded to Boinc on a new Dell XPS400 D 3.0g with 1 gig of ddr2 533 and running XP SP2 Media center. I am only running a Seti client. Installed Boinc 25 Dec it was running fine for a day and a half. When I checked it today I found 13 copies of Boinc in the system tray. All were for the same WU but stopped at different stages of processing.when selected they update to the current percentage completed. Closing them presents no problem. But a few minutes latter Boinc goes blank and an error message pops up saying manager has lost contact with the Seti client. First time I ever read something of this kind. The problem seems to be with connecting to loacalhost. Make sure that boincmgr.exe and boinc.exe are not blocked by the firewall (which they probably aren't - but just to be sure).
